Hey everyone 👋
Thanks so much for requesting a Trello integration — especially the shout for two-way sync and cleaner workflows between the two platforms.
Here’s what’s available today:
- You can import Trello boards directly into ClickUp with structure, comments, attachments, statuses, and more using our built-in import tool.

- For 2 way syncing, tools like Make.com, Zapier, and n8n allow you to automate workflows between ClickUp and Trello.
